This past Sunday, we began the season of Advent, and Rev. Joe Dewey preached on God’s judgment and our call to look honestly and hopefully at the world. Citing Jeremiah 33:16 and Psalm 121, he emphasized that Advent starts in darkness, inviting us to confront life’s dangers and our own shortcomings with honesty. Rev. Dewey reminded us that judgment, though sobering, leads to hope and flourishing. His message challenged us to remain alert and place our hope not in fleeting things but in God’s promises of a future safe city where true justice and peace will reign.
